For example, from the root -kart-, the following words can be derived: Kartveli (a Georgian person), Kartuli (the Georgian language) and Sakartvelo (Georgia). The language, like Basque, is considered to be a language isolate, meaning it formed independently from any other language and therefore bears no resemblance to any languages other than those that branched from Georgian and developed alongside it, called the Kartvelian languages. By using a root, and adding some definite prefixes and suffixes, one can derive many nouns and adjectives from the root. The first two are used together as upper and lower case in the writings of the Georgian Orthodox Church and together are called Khutsuri "priests' [alphabet]". Georgian has a simple 5-vowel system: front rounded i, e , back rounded u, o, and neutral a (5-vowel systems are actually the most common vowel systems among the world's languages). The Georgian alphabet probably evolved around the fifth century with characters possibly derived from a variety of eastern Aramaic.
